Wow, out finally, even though still needing some checks
- uploading some instructions about the new model. It is an extended version of the classic LA2A compressor. It is extended to cover all Bus controls. More about this soon. Note: set release to auto, side-lo to50%, attack to max, use side-hi to increase highs compression to get it.
- NOTE: attack and release knobs have a better scaling, you need to check your settings!
- Mac version coming immediately.
- Why links before uploads? They are automated, which one completes first. So night time isn't wasted!
- Tube76 model issue was solved here but looks like it is still there somewhere. Focusing on it and solving before any other activity. I'll announce the replacement of the files under the same links.
Yes, a serious user area is almost ready
